As one of the first residential developments in a historically industrial area of Portland’s eastside, the Modera Belmont apartments is poised to bring vitality to its neighborhood. While it now stands out as a modern and iconic building with bold massing, it is designed to become a cornerstone of anticipated urban development in this area.
The ground floor of Modera Belmont is devoted to retail, with the upper five stories consisting of a mix of studios, lofts, and one- and two-bedroom apartments. The interior finishes incorporate nature-inspired materials and patterns with an emphasis on handcrafts – a characteristic of Portland culture. Wood elements throughout the building pay respect to our timber town history. Local makers and artists added their talents with one-of-a-kind furniture pieces, area rugs, original artwork and murals.
Resident amenity spaces include a lounge adjacent to the lobby, as well as a fitness room, bike lounge and repair room on the first floor. Upper floors feature a video game room, a common room on the top floor, and a rooftop terrace with views of the river and downtown. A central courtyard provides public space along the street, with private areas further back. The courtyard also manages all of the stormwater onsite through elegant concrete, steel and wood planters.
